Abstract

The utility model discloses engineering project progress management equipment applied to building construction enterprises, which comprises a first solar panel, a second solar panel and an illuminating lamp, wherein the first solar panel and the second solar panel are electrically connected with the illuminating lamp, and the illuminating lamp is connected to the lower end of the second solar panel, and the equipment further comprises: a posting board for posting a schedule; the first solar panel and the second solar panel are connected to the upper end of the pasting and placing plate; the fixing rods are symmetrically and fixedly connected to two sides of the sticking and placing plate; according to the utility model, the form is conveniently pasted through the pasting and placing plate, the first solar panel and the second solar panel are conveniently controlled to be unfolded and closed through the supporting rod, the pull rod and the connecting rod, the first solar panel and the second solar panel are convenient to provide power for the illuminating lamp, and the form can be conveniently watched at night.

Background
The building construction refers to production activities in the engineering construction implementation stage, is the construction process of various buildings, and can also be said to be the process of changing various lines on the design drawing into a real object in a designated place; in order to ensure that a construction project can be completed smoothly, the construction progress needs to be managed in a planned way so as to ensure the working efficiency;
carry out construction progress management now and adopt the computer to print out the engineering progress table more, paste the scene, be used for carrying out construction progress supervision, remind the workman to press the completion work of quality simultaneously, but the present show fence that is used for posting the engineering progress table, mostly be disposable, will be abandoned after a project scene uses up, the reason is because the volume on show fence is too big, inconvenient taking away, therefore every project scene need use when showing the fence, only can make newly in addition, the waste of resource has been caused, consequently, the engineering project progress management equipment who is applied to in the construction enterprise has been proposed.

referring to fig. 1-3, be applied to engineering project progress management equipment in building construction enterprise, including first solar panel 3, second solar panel 4, light, first solar panel 3, second solar panel 4 all with light electric connection to the light is connected at the lower extreme of second solar panel 4, still includes: a pasting and placing plate 1 for pasting a schedule; the first solar panel 3 and the second solar panel 4 are connected to the upper end of the pasting and placing plate 1; the fixed rods 2 are symmetrically and fixedly connected to two sides of the sticking and placing plate 1; the supporting rod 5 is connected to the lower end of the fixing rod 2 in a sliding mode and used for supporting the pasting and placing plate 1; and the supporting part is connected to one end, far away from the supporting rod 5, of the fixing rod 2 and is used for supporting the first solar panel 3 and the second solar panel 4.
When the device is used, the device is firstly installed at a use place, the lower end of the support rod 5 is connected with the fixed foot pad 6, the fixed foot pad 6 is tightly installed on the ground by matching the fastening bolt with the fixing through hole on the fixed foot pad 6, and the first solar panel 3 and the second solar panel 4 can provide power for the illuminating lamp, so that a worker can see a form on the pasting and placing plate 1 at night;
the second fixing pin 15 is separated from the baffle 14, the baffle 14 is released, the baffle 14 slides downwards, the inner side of the pasting and placing plate 1 is exposed, a form to be pasted is pasted on the pasting and placing plate 1, then the baffle 14 is installed back to the original position, and the second fixing pin 15 is fixed on the pasting and placing plate 1, so that the form is protected to a certain extent;
when changing project sites, the first fixing pin 12 is pulled out to be disengaged from the supporting rod 5, the supporting rod 5 is released, the fixing rod 2 slides downwards, the pasting board 1 is fixedly connected with the fixing rod 2, the pasting board 1 moves downwards, when the fixing rod 2 moves downwards, the upper end of the supporting rod 5 slides in the first sliding groove 7, the pull rod 9 and the supporting rod 5 are connected in the second sliding groove 8 in a sliding manner, the pull rod 9 slides in the second sliding groove 8, when the pull rod 9 contacts the bottom end of the second sliding groove 8, the supporting rod 5 can also continue to move upwards, the pull rod 9 moves upwards under the pushing of the supporting rod 5, the connecting rod 10 is rotatably connected with the pull rod 9, the connecting rod 10 rotates under the pushing of the pull rod 9, and the connecting rod 10 is connected with the first solar panel 3 and the second solar panel 4, so as to push the first solar panel 3, the second solar panel 4, Second solar panel 4 rotates, reaches the purpose of packing up solar panel, conveniently transports, because bracing piece 5 also contracts simultaneously into dead lever 2 in, further made things convenient for transporting, breaks away from the matching with ground with fixed callus on the sole 6, can remove this device.
